
"Resilience" is a good name for this book
Good book, well written and quite compelling most of the time. This gracious lady has faced more than her share of adversity and has come through tough times with strength and 'resilience'. I did expect the book to be more about her current troubles with husband John; however, the majority of this book discusses the death of her son Wade in an automobile accident and her resulting grief and the changes she made to cope. She also discusses at length her extended family, including her parents, and their resilience throughout their lives.
I admire Elizabeth Edwards, if for nothing more than her ability to face adversity and maintain the composure she consistently shows. She's an example for us all. God Bless Her.
